Engaging Students with Socratic Seminar is designed to help K-12 educators using Socratic seminar as a literacy tool to promote student learning and improve academic success.
Number of Units: 3.0 graduate level extension credit(s) in semester hours
Who Should Attend: This course provides continuing education for teachers (K-12). Coursework is adaptable for elementary grades.
